The Brooklyn Nets overcame all the ‘troubles’ that people assumed they would have after Game 4. The Nets came back home, James Harden made his way to the lineup, and the Nets secured the win. Kevin Durant scored a mammoth 49 points, grabbed 17 rebounds, and dished 10 assists. Jeff Green rose to the occasion and scored 27 points, while Blake Griffin added 17 points as well.
James Harden, despite returning to the floor, could not contribute much. Harden played for 46 minutes, yet finished the game with 5 points, 6 rebounds, and 8 assists. His performance was quite shocking for everyone. Although no one expected him to go off for 50 in his return, these numbers are not what one expects of a star of his caliber.
